From 96b38fbb35a69286b98e72f7f9c4a5d205724616 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Diana Picus Date: Thu, 16 Oct 2025 13:48:09 +0200 Subject: [PATCH 1/3] [AMDGPU] Add intrinsic exposing s_alloc_vgpr Make it possible to use `s_alloc_vgpr` at the IR level. This is a huge footgun and use for anything other than compiler internal purposes is heavily discouraged. The calling code must make sure that it does not allocate fewer VGPRs than necessary - the intrinsic is NOT a request to the backend to limit the number of VGPRs it uses (in essence it's not so different from what we do with the dynamic VGPR flags of the `amdgcn.cs.chain` intrinsic, it just makes it possible to use this functionality in other scenarios). --- llvm/include/llvm/IR/IntrinsicsAMDGPU.td | 11 ++++ .../AMDGPU/AMDGPUInstructionSelector.cpp | 16 +++++ .../Target/AMDGPU/AMDGPURegisterBankInfo.cpp | 4 ++ .../Target/AMDGPU/AMDGPUSearchableTables.td | 1 + llvm/lib/Target/AMDGPU/SOPInstructions.td | 6 +- .../AMDGPU/always_uniform.ll | 9 +++ .../AMDGPU/intrinsic-amdgcn-s-alloc-vgpr.ll | 59 +++++++++++++++++++ 7 files changed, 104 insertions(+), 2 deletions(-) create mode 100644 llvm/test/CodeGen/AMDGPU/intrinsic-amdgcn-s-alloc-vgpr.ll diff --git a/llvm/include/llvm/IR/IntrinsicsAMDGPU.td b/llvm/include/llvm/IR/IntrinsicsAMDGPU.td index ded00b1274670..9bb305823e932 100644 --- a/llvm/include/llvm/IR/IntrinsicsAMDGPU.td +++ b/llvm/include/llvm/IR/IntrinsicsAMDGPU.td @@ -391,6 +391,17 @@ def int_amdgcn_s_wait_loadcnt : AMDGPUWaitIntrinsic; def int_amdgcn_s_wait_samplecnt : AMDGPUWaitIntrinsic; def int_amdgcn_s_wait_storecnt : AMDGPUWaitIntrinsic; +// Force the VGPR allocation of the current wave to (at least) the given value. +// The actual number of allocated VGPRs may be rounded up to match hardware +// block boundaries. +// It is the responsibility of the calling code to ensure it does not allocate +// below the VGPR requirements of the current shader. +def int_amdgcn_s_alloc_vgpr : + Intrinsic< + [llvm_i1_ty], // Returns true if the allocation succeeded, false otherwise. + [llvm_i32_ty], // The number of VGPRs to allocate. + [NoUndef, IntrNoMem, IntrHasSideEffects, IntrConvergent, IntrWillReturn, IntrNoCallback, IntrNoFree]>; + def int_amdgcn_div_scale : DefaultAttrsIntrinsic< // 1st parameter: Numerator // 2nd parameter: Denominator diff --git a/llvm/lib/Target/AMDGPU/AMDGPUInstructionSelector.cpp b/llvm/lib/Target/AMDGPU/AMDGPUInstructionSelector.cpp index 12915c7344426..2f9c87cb5f20e 100644 --- a/llvm/lib/Target/AMDGPU/AMDGPUInstructionSelector.cpp +++ b/llvm/lib/Target/AMDGPU/AMDGPUInstructionSelector.cpp @@ -2331,6 +2331,22 @@ bool AMDGPUInstructionSelector::selectG_INTRINSIC_W_SIDE_EFFECTS( case Intrinsic::amdgcn_ds_bvh_stack_push8_pop1_rtn: case Intrinsic::amdgcn_ds_bvh_stack_push8_pop2_rtn: return selectDSBvhStackIntrinsic(I); + case Intrinsic::amdgcn_s_alloc_vgpr: { + // S_ALLOC_VGPR doesn't have a destination register, it just implicitly sets + // SCC.
